How to configure Braking related parameters BRC for Altivar ATV340 drives when using ATV Regen unit?
If [Brake assignment] BLC is assigned, the function that tests the connection of braking resistor is automatically activated ([Braking Resistor] BRC =[Yes] yes ). If the braking resistors are not detected, it triggers the [DB unit op. circuit] BUFO error.
Without having braking resistor [Braking Resistor] BRC must be set to [No] afterwards.
The same applicable if Altivar Regenerative Unit is used.
If ATV980 is used (not ATV340), additionally it is necessary to configure supply as ATV supply unit REC
BRC parameter can be found in menu Complete setting - Generic functions - Ramps
Extract from hoisting application note:
Set [Braking Resistor] BRC to [No] NO on ATV340 and ATV900 if Altivar Regenerative Unit is used.
Additionally, if AFE unit is used with drives different from ATV980, set [DC Bus Source Type] DCBS to [Supply Unit REC] SUREC
